Armandas Kučys (born 27 February 2003) is a Lithuanian football player. He plays for the Under-19 squad of the Swedish club Kalmar FF.

He made his debut for Lithuania national football team on 15 November 2021 in a friendly against Kuwait.[1]
His father Aurimas Kučys is a former Lithuanian international footballer.[2]
